From: A positive feed-forward loop between LncRNA-URRCC and EGFL7/P-AKT/FOXO3 signaling promotes proliferation and metastasis of clear cell renal cell carcinoma

Fig. 1

URRCC is a novel lncRNA involved in renal malignant transformation. a: Comparison of BX649059 expression in 20 paired renal cancer tissues and adjacent non-cancer tissues via qRT-PCR. b: BX649059 expression in ccRCC tissues and normal tissues from TCGA KIRC dataset. c: BX649059 expression was determined via qRT-PCR in 96 renal cancer tissues and 25 unpaired non-cancerous renal tissues. d: URRCC expression in a series of RCC cell lines (OSRC-2, 769-P, ACHN, Caki-1, 786-O and A498) and human normal renal tubular epithelial cell line HK-2. e: RNA FISH analysis of URRCC (green) in adjacent tissues and ccRCC tissues while the nucleuses were stained with DAPI (blue). f: qRT-PCR for URRCC, U6 and β-actin from RNA extracted from cytoplasmic and nuclear fractions. g: Of the enrolled 116 cases, the relative URRCC mRNA levels were tested in convenience of the logistic regression analysis. h: Kaplan–Meier analyses of the correlations between URRCC expression level and overall survival of 116 patients with RCC. The median expression level was used as the cutoff
